Objective To investigate the correlation between serum lipocalin 2(LCN-2),thrombospondin 2(TSP-2)levels and renal function and prognosis in patients with diabetes nephropathy(DN).Methods One hundred and fifty-five DN patients admitted to the Endocrinology Department of the First Affiliated Hospital of the Chinese People's Liberation Ar-my Air Force Medical University from January 2018 to December 2020 were selected as the DN group,70 simple T2DM pa-tients during the same period were selected as the simple T2DM group,and 70 healthy individuals during the same period were selected as the healthy control group.Based on the 3-year prognosis,DN patients were divided into 38 poor prognosis subgroups and 117 good prognosis subgroups.Serum LCN-2 and TSP-2 levels and renal function indicators were detected[estimated glomerular filtration rate(eGFR),urinary albumin creatinine ratio(UACR)];Pearson's method was used to analyze the correlation between serum LCN-2,TSP-2 levels and renal function indicators in DN patients;Logistic regression model was used to analyze the factors contributing to poor prognosis in DN patients;Receiver operating characteristic(ROC)curve was established to evaluate the predictive value of serum LCN-2 and TSP-2 levels for poor prognosis in DN patients.Results The serum levels of LCN-2,TSP-2,and UACR in the healthy control group,simple T2DM group,and DN group increased sequentially,while eGFR decreased sequentially(F/P=48.365/<0.001,57.480/<0.001,218.946/<0.001,253.488/<0.001);The 3 year incidence of poor prognosis in 155 DN patients was 24.52%(38/155);Compared with the subgroup with good prognosis,the subgroup with poor prognosis had higher LCN-2,TSP-2,UACR,and lower eGFR(t/P=7.057/<0.001,6.457/<0.001,4.967/<0.001,5.398/<0.001);The serum levels of LCN-2 and TSP-2 in DN patients were negatively correlated with eGFR(r/P=-0.745/<0.001,-0.731/<0.001),and positively correlated with UACR(r/P=0.703/<0.001,0.691/<0.001);Multivariate logistic regression showed that stage 4 chronic kidney disease,high glycated hemoglobin,high UACR,high LCN-2,and high TSP-2 were independent risk factors for poor prognosis in DN patients[OR(95%CI)=3.972(1.121-14.076),1.640(1.024-2.628),1.015(1.002-1.030),1.016(1.005-1.027),1.196(1.077-1.328)],and high eGFR was an inde-pendent protective factor[OR(95%6I)=0.959(0.924-0.994)];The area under the curve(AUC)of serum LCN-2,TSP-2 lev-els,and their combined prediction of adverse prognosis in DN patients were 0.795,0.783,and 0.882,respectively.The com-bined AUC of the two was greater than the AUC predicted solely by serum LCN-2 and TSP-2 levels(Z/P=3.200/0.001,2.680/0.007).Conclusion The elevated levels of serum LCN-2 and TSP-2 in DN patients are closely related to decreased re-nal function and prognosis.The combination of serum LCN-2 and TSP-2 levels has a high value in predicting the prognosis ofDN patients.
